WebThe Howard League in Canterbury fronted many attempts to improve the penal system in New Zealand. The anti-flogging, anti-capital punishment stance also included a push towards 'scientific' methods of prison reform, including a rehabilitative approach, psychological assessments of prisoners and humane treatment. WebThe Howard League for Penal Reform takes its name from the 18th-century English penal reformer John Howard. It grew out of the Howard Association, set up in Britain in 1866 to advocate humane treatment of prisoners, and the Penal Reform League, founded in 1907.

It is the oldest penal reform organisation in the world, named after John Howard. It was founded as the Howard Association in 1866 and changed its name in 1921, following a merger with the Penal Reform League.
